Output b1d84b8824ee88e3cfd79e6459eb2dee753c8862e4c51db9cc06b5617a2fa286:1

value
1064162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 064ff2824935926ab4b1f3b99d02aa0114abc966 OP_EQUAL
address
32GPkXj3x6YUueFyvbLSaucwLYpKSYu1Sx
transaction
b1d84b8824ee88e3cfd79e6459eb2dee753c8862e4c51db9cc06b5617a2fa286
confirmations
312359
spent
true